## Local Setup — Cron Drift Tooling (Wrenfall Ops)

If you are on call and need to reproduce the cron drift, install the probe CLI from the tools directory and sync your clock source to the stub NTP container first. The probe writes scheduled-vs-actual timestamps into the drift_events table every minute. Point the probe at the local ops database using the connection string below.

primary connection of tajeg-tajop = postgresql://julax_svc:DI@db-e7f3.kelvidyn.corp:5432/rusdor

Subject: Roof-terrace door

Hi all,

Welcome to Brindlewood House. A quick heads-up for new starters: the roof-terrace door on level 6 keeps jamming in damp weather. Push firmly at the top corner and it will release — please don't force the handle. If it sticks completely, call the front desk. Until the hinge is replaced, the override pass below will open it.

badge for hagug-yagaf: bdg-CUQCLS-57047080

### Action item: fix gateway rate limiting defaults

During the Pinloft incident, plugin traffic through the Asterhook gateway blew past the soft limits because our defaults assumed polite retry behavior—turns out most plugins hammer on 429s. We're shipping saner defaults and asking plugin authors to honor the retry-after header going forward. If your plugin needs more headroom, request a quota bump rather than retrying faster; we will throttle harder otherwise. The new default window, burst, and penalty constants are listed below.

limits module of fajog-tawig:
RATE_LIMITS = {
    "druwyn": 2,
    "quenael": 10,
    "wenix": 2,
    "druael": 2,
}

**Deploy step 4 — DuskPanel dark mode rollout**

Once the theme assets for the admin dashboard pass visual regression, build the production bundle with the dark-mode flag enabled. The CDN edge requires signed bundles, so run the signing step before upload — skipping it causes a silent fallback to the old light-only build, which is exactly the bug we chased last sprint. Verify the signature locally, then push to the Harrowfield edge cluster. Sign using the key below.

deploy key for tajep-fahif: bky19_Hsbh6jHLfHtPXqpEhcy